Summer Challenges for Seniors
Aging bodies are more vulnerable to heat-related illnesses, dehydration, and fatigue. Many seniors also take medications or manage chronic conditions that increase their sensitivity to extreme temperatures. Add in the social shift of summer—family vacations, school breaks, disrupted schedules—and isolation can easily take root.
Summer Safety Tips for Senior Well-Being
Whether you're caring for a parent, grandparent, or client, here are key ways to keep them safe and happy during the summer:
Stay Hydrated: Encourage water intake throughout the day, even if they aren’t thirsty. Dehydration can happen quickly.
Wear Light Clothing: Choose breathable, light-colored fabrics to stay cool.
Avoid Peak Heat: Plan activities early in the morning or after sunset to avoid midday heat.
Keep the Home Cool: Use fans, air conditioning, or cooling cloths to regulate indoor temperature.
Monitor Medications: Some medications can increase sun sensitivity or reduce hydration—review them with a healthcare provider.
Encourage Connection: Loneliness can increase during summer. Schedule visits, phone calls, or companion care to keep spirits high.
